Book excerpt: The end of the Cold War has undermined the notion that the sovereignty of African states is sacrosanct. In explaining the Sources of Conflict in the Post-Colonial African State, this book identifies another structural layer of interaction; intermestic. This analytic layer is advanced as crucial for comprehensive and in depth appreciation of the dynamic of conflict in the post-colonial African state. It also facilitates understandings of the process of the implosion and crisis of African states system.
